What is the VA Conceal Carry and Home Defense Fundamentals class?
The Concealed Carry and Home Defense Fundamentals is a comprehensive course for anyone considering owning or carrying a firearm for self-defense. The course is a complete guide to understanding conflict avoidance and situational awareness; home security and home defense; handgun, shotgun and AR-15 basics; shooting fundamentals; the physiology of violent encounters; the legal aspects of using deadly force (including knowing what to do in the aftermath); and a complete guide on gear, gadgets, and ongoing training.
Upon completion of the course you will receive a certificate that is recognized as your instructional course for a Virginia Concealed Carry permit. Simply take the certificate, along with your completed Application for Concealed Handgun Permit Form SP-248 to your General District Court to apply.

Who is the USCCA?
The United States Concealed Carry Association is one of the most respected organizations in the firearms community and an authority on concealed carry laws, firearms safety and home defense. Formed in 2003, USCCA President Tim Schmidt together with co-founder Tonnie Schmidt set out to build a resource for people interested in expanding their knowledge of firearm safety and home defense. With the launch of Concealed Carry Magazine and an online forum, the USCCA was born. They offer resources to learn your rights and responsibilities as a gun owner and develop your concealed carry confidence.
The Yamasaki Academy Woodbridge is not affiliated in any way with the USCCA or any other firearms organizations. It is, however, the organization under which all of our firearms instructors are personally certified.
